Mastering data science means getting cosy with statistics and machine learning basics. Understanding measures like mean, median, variance, and standard deviation is vital. These measures are fundamental to analysing data, offering insights, and making data forecasts.
These statistical measures do not just aid in analysis. They are the building blocks of machine learning models. These models depend on statistical principles for their precision and effectiveness. For instance, knowing about variance and standard deviation is critical for normalising data: This step ensures equal contribution of all features during a model's training phase.
Moreover, these statistical tools are invaluable in evaluating a modelโs performance and guiding data scientists in refining their models for better outcomes. Machine learning, a vital part of data science, utilises these statistical underpinnings to develop models that can predict or decide autonomously, picking clues from data and improving over time.

Knowing the must-have tools and technologies is indispensable for anyone starting in data science. Python and R are the go-to programming languages, each offering specialised data analysis and modelling libraries. Visualisation tools like Matplotlib, Seaborn, and ggplot2 play a significant role in revealing insights graphically. Platforms such as AWS and SAS offer the necessary infrastructure for tackling large-scale data science endeavours. These tools form the backbone of data processing, analysis, and visualisation, empowering you to manage vast data sets efficiently and derive meaningful conclusions.
